Sungrow, a global leader in PV inverters and energy storage systems, has unveiled its C&I PowerStack On&Off-Grid Solar-Storage solution at Intersolar Europe, expanding its portfolio of advanced energy solutions for commercial and industrial users.
The launch comes at a time when businesses worldwide are facing rising electricity costs and growing concerns over grid reliability. Designed to ensure uninterrupted power supply while supporting sustainability and decarbonization objectives, the PowerStack solution combines flexible system architecture with multi-scenario adaptability to deliver reliable and efficient energy management.
The system supports a wide range of operating modes, including Virtual Power Plant (VPP), demand control, Virtual Synchronous Generator (VSG), backup power, seamless grid switching, and black-start capability. These features enable the solution to adapt effectively to diverse grid environments and operational requirements, helping businesses enhance energy resilience while optimizing power usage.
Two Architectures for Different Customer Needs
-DC-Coupled: Native All-in-One Seamless Backup
The DC-coupled solution combines the SH125CX hybrid inverter with the ST245CS-S energy storage system. Solar, battery storage, and diesel generation operate as one integrated energy system, enabling seamless transitions between grid-connected and off-grid operation.
For facilities with power demands of up to 250 kW, the solution eliminates the need for an additional automatic transfer switch (ATS) cabinet, reducing upfront investment and simplifying system design. Solar energy can also charge the battery directly, improving overall system efficiency and maximizing renewable energy utilization.
-AC-Coupled: Independent & Flexible Seamless Backup
Combining the SG series PV inverter with ST255CS storage and ATS1250, the system seamlessly takes over loads on grid failure; during extended outages, the diesel generator can be commanded to start and synchronize smoothly. The storage system integrates with existing PV systems through plug-and-play installation, requiring no modifications and keeping retrofit costs low.
New facilities benefit most from DC-coupled architecture for its superior cost-efficiency and existing facilities are best served by AC-coupled architecture for its minimal retrofit investment. The optimal solution depends on each customer’s energy requirements and infrastructure.
Full Scenario Coverage Across C&I Applications
The solution is designed for wide-ranging applications, covering on-grid, on&off-grid, and off-grid scenarios. It supports deployment in commercial buildings such as retail shops and offices, as well as agriculture facilities, logistics hubs, and island resort standalone power systems.
Its versatility has been demonstrated in diverse real-world scenarios, from a fully off-grid sawmill in South Australia to weak-grid applications in Cambodia. Across different infrastructure environments, Sungrow’s solution helps customers maintain critical power, reduce diesel reliance and build more sustainable operations.
